Transaction 23e05715f53eac7fd8a86f50a3edc0d9e530b8ee96b1ea088337c83f70399d41
1 Input
1 Output
-
23e05715f53eac7fd8a86f50a3edc0d9e530b8ee96b1ea088337c83f70399d41:0
- value
- 669886
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 df6fdc1cb75bb78c222d2a42a5253cf0df2af75b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MNRgwBqxJFX3ejHgKVP5DpLhUo271PMA9